Progression through the mansion's five primary wings is strictly gated by your ability to match the right charm to the surrounding environmental context. Players must examine wall carvings, read historical journals scattered throughout the rooms, and decode the subtle visual cues given by the mansion's residents to figure out which floral frequency will grant passage. 3.
